[Python] or

lordkrandel lordkrandel a gmail.com
Sab 29 Mar 2014 20:16:28 CET


On 29/03/2014 20:02, Diego Barrera wrote:
>> >>>{1,1,5,1352467,12,1,5,2} | {2,7,3,54,6,21,1,45,6,87}
>> {1, 2, 3, 5, 6, 7, 12, 45, 1352467, 21, 54, 87}
>>
>> Certo che puoi reimplementarli daccapo, ma perché ??
> Posso dire che trovano molto impiego in calcoli matematici?
> Grazie mille
>
> PS: i tuoi insiemi contengono solo numeri.. e' un indizio o ci sono 
> solo numeri
> perche' e' piu' veloce l'inserimento?
E' solo un esempio a caso, con la cosa piú veloce da scrivere :D !

Serve molto anche se lavori con i Database.
Metti caso che hai 300 clienti e 300 fornitori, ognuno con la sua cittá 
di appartenenza.
Hai estratto con SQL i due elenchi delle cittá, ma vuoi unirli e non 
avere duplicati.
 >>> {'Mantova', 'Cremona'} | {'Cremona', 'Lucca'}
{'Lucca', 'Cremona', 'Mantova'}

Possono anche essere insiemi con tipi eterogenei...
 >>> {'Mantova', 'Cremona'} | {'Cremona', 'Lucca', 3}
{3, 'Lucca', 'Cremona', 'Mantova'}


-- 
Paolo Gatti



Maggiori informazioni sulla lista Python